A sky above the sofa, at any hour of the day.
A living room is where a home relaxes. It is also the room we spend the most waking hours in, which makes the quality of its light a decision that shapes most of the day.
Daylight does something ordinary lighting struggles to do. It changes through the day, and our bodies read that change. Bright, cool light through the afternoon keeps us alert. Warm, low light in the evening tells us the day is ending. A living room with no daylight offers none of that, so the room feels the same at three as it does at nine. Give it a sky and the space also feels larger, because the eye is drawn upward and the ceiling stops being the limit of the room.

Why it works here
Health and mood
Regular exposure to daylight helps regulate sleep, lifts mood and supports mental wellbeing.
A connection to nature
We are outdoor beings who live indoors. Our eyes want to see sky, and a room that gives them one feels different to be in.
A more spacious feel
Light draws the eye upward, so compact rooms and low ceilings feel considerably larger and more open.
Circadian rhythm
The colour and brightness shift every 6 seconds to follow the real sun at your location.
Better days, better nights
A daylight cycle indoors helps balance the body clock, supporting performance through the day and sleep at the end of it.

True colour
Ra98 colour rendering across the full spectrum, so skin, food, timber and stone all look the way they should.
All the light, none of the heat
No radiant heat, no UV and no solar gain, whatever the sky outside is doing.
Risk free installation
No roof penetrations, no risk of water ingress and no roof access required.
Fast installation
No waiting on multiple trades or good weather. Most installations need only an electrician.
Light control
Run it from our touch panel, the app, or your own DALI controls.
Fits almost any ceiling
Suspended, surface mounted or recessed, needing 200mm of cavity and as little as 150mm for the 1500 x 300mm.
